House Energy Panel Hearing Highlights GOP’s Early Fossil Fuel Pitches

January 31, 2023
House energy committee Republicans at their first hearing this Congress showcased early proposals for ramping up fossil fuel energy production, including calls to speed permitting of natural gas and other energy projects and require power grid officials to stop what lawmakers say is deprioritizing reliability in favor of renewables.
